iis服务器助手广告广告
返回顶部
首页 > 资讯 > 精选 >mysql多字段排序优化的方法是什么
  • 353
分享到

mysql多字段排序优化的方法是什么

mysql 2024-04-09 20:04:48 353人浏览 独家记忆
摘要

在 Mysql 中,可以通过使用多字段排序来优化查询性能。以下是一些优化方法: 确保查询中的字段添加了合适的索引。在多字段排序中,

Mysql 中,可以通过使用多字段排序优化查询性能。以下是一些优化方法:

  1. 确保查询中的字段添加了合适的索引。在多字段排序中,如果查询中的字段都有索引,mysql 可以更快地排序数据。可以使用 EXPLaiN 命令来查看查询执行计划,确保索引被正确使用。

  2. 尽量避免在排序字段上使用函数或表达式。如果在排序字段上使用函数或表达式,Mysql 将无法有效使用索引,导致性能下降。尽量在查询中避免使用函数或表达式,或者考虑在查询中添加虚拟列来存储计算结果。

  3. 使用覆盖索引。如果查询中只需要排序字段和索引字段的数据,可以使用覆盖索引来减少 io 操作,从而提高性能。

  4. 考虑使用复合索引。如果查询中同时涉及多个字段进行排序,可以考虑创建复合索引来覆盖这些字段。复合索引可以让 MySQL 在排序时更高效地使用索引。

  5. 如果可能的话,限制结果集大小。如果查询返回的结果集很大,可以考虑在排序字段上添加限制条件,以减少排序的数据量,从而提高性能。

通过以上方法,可以优化 MySQL 中多字段排序的性能,提高查询效率。

--结束END--

本文标题: mysql多字段排序优化的方法是什么

本文链接: https://www.lsjlt.com/news/599685.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• mysql多字段排序优化的方法是什么
    在 MySQL 中,可以通过使用多字段排序来优化查询性能。以下是一些优化方法: 确保查询中的字段添加了合适的索引。在多字段排序中,...
    99+
    2024-04-09
    mysql
  • sql多字段排序的方法是什么
    在SQL中,可以使用ORDER BY子句来对多个字段进行排序。可以按照多个字段的优先级进行排序,例如: SELECT col...
    99+
    2024-04-30
    sql
  • mysql排序优化的方法是什么
    MySQL排序优化的方法有以下几种: 索引优化:为排序的列创建索引,可以大幅提高排序的效率。可以考虑创建单列索引、组合索引或者覆...
    99+
    2024-04-09
    mysql
  • mysql两个字段排序的方法是什么
    通过使用 ORDER BY 子句可以对MySQL查询的结果进行排序。如果想要按照多个字段进行排序,可以在ORDER BY子句中同时指...
    99+
    2024-04-17
    mysql
  • oracle按字段排序的方法是什么
    在Oracle中,可以使用ORDER BY子句来按字段排序查询结果集。ORDER BY子句可以在SELECT语句的末尾指定一...
    99+
    2024-04-09
    oracle
  • mysql大文本字段优化的方法是什么
    非常抱歉,由于您没有提供文章标题,我无法为您生成一篇高质量的文章。请您提供文章标题,我将尽快为您生成一篇优质的文章。...
    99+
    2024-05-14
  • PHP 数组多字段排序的技巧与优化
    在 php 中,可以使用内置函数和优化技术实现多字段排序:使用 usort() 函数和自定义比较函数,基于多个字段排序数组。使用匿名函数简化代码,实现多字段排序。使用第三方库(如 sor...
    99+
    2024-04-27
    php 多字段排序
  • mysql多字段去重的方法是什么
    MySQL中多字段去重的方法可以使用GROUP BY语句来实现。具体步骤如下:1. 使用SELECT语句选择需要去重的字段,...
    99+
    2023-08-30
    mysql
  • oracle多个字段排序规则是什么
    在Oracle中,多个字段的排序规则是根据字段的顺序进行排序的。即先按照第一个字段进行排序,如果第一个字段的值相同,则根据第二个字段...
    99+
    2023-09-09
    oracle
  • mysql多条件排序的方法是什么
    在MySQL中,可以通过ORDER BY子句和多个列名来实现多条件排序。例如,可以使用以下语法来对多个列进行排序: SELEC...
    99+
    2024-03-02
    mysql
  • mysql多个字段去重的方法是什么
    在MySQL中,可以使用DISTINCT关键字来去重多个字段。例如,假设有一个名为table_name的表,包含字段column1和...
    99+
    2023-10-23
    mysql
  • mysql多字段模糊查询的方法是什么
    在MySQL中进行多字段模糊查询的方法是使用OR运算符连接多个LIKE条件。 例如,假设有一个名为users的表,其中包含name和...
    99+
    2024-04-09
    mysql
  • mysql多条件排序的实现方法是什么
    MySQL中可以使用ORDER BY子句来实现多条件排序。ORDER BY子句可以接受多个排序条件,每个条件可以是升序(ASC)或降...
    99+
    2023-08-25
    mysql
  • mysql多字段排序无效怎么解决
    当多字段排序无效时,可能是由于排序字段的顺序或数据类型不正确所导致的。以下是一些解决方法: 确保字段的顺序正确:在使用多字段排序...
    99+
    2024-04-09
    mysql
  • mysql中distinct多个字段去重的方法是什么
    在MySQL中,可以使用GROUP BY子句来实现多个字段的去重。具体的语法如下: SELECT DISTINCT colu...
    99+
    2024-04-09
    mysql
  • mysql多表关联优化的方法是什么
    优化多表关联的方法有以下几种: 使用索引:在关联字段上建立索引可以加快查询速度。确保每个表的关联字段都有索引,并且尽量使用覆盖索引...
    99+
    2024-03-06
    mysql
  • element Table表格组件多字段(多列)排序方法
    目录需求:遇到的问题:解决:需求: element表格多列排序,点击日期的排序,然后再点击姓名的排序,将两个排序字段传给后端排序 遇到的问题: element的Table组件只支持...
    99+
    2024-04-02
  • mysql字段拼接的方法是什么
    非常抱歉,由于您没有提供文章标题,我无法为您生成一篇高质量的文章。请您提供文章标题,我将尽快为您生成一篇优质的文章。...
    99+
    2024-05-21
  • mysql添加字段的方法是什么
    要在MySQL数据库中添加字段,可以使用ALTER TABLE语句。以下是一个示例: ALTER TABLE table_name ...
    99+
    2024-04-09
    mysql
  • MySQL优化的方法是什么
    这篇文章主要介绍“MySQL优化的方法是什么”,在日常操作中,相信很多人在MySQL优化的方法是什么问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”MySQL优化的方法是什么”...
    99+
    2024-04-02
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作